0 Replies Latest reply on Apr 12, 2010 11:13 PM by jalateras

    BadMagicException starting broker

    jalateras

      I have a situation where i get a org.apache.activemq.kaha.impl.index.BadMagicException exception when my broker is starting up.

       

      Here is the stack trace

       

      org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'dispatcherManager' defined in class path resource : Invocation of init method failed; nested exception is au.com.observant.ringocore.dispatcher.api.manager.DispatcherManagerException: Failed to start message broker component

           at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1337)

           at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:473)

           at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ory$1.run(AbstractAutowireCapableBeanFactory.java:409)

           at java.security.AccessController.doPrivileged(Native Method)

           at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:380)

           at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:264)

           at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:221)

           at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:261)

           at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:185)

           at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:164)

           at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:429)

           at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:729)

           at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:381)

           at au.com.observant.server.Hub.startDispatcher(Hub.java:1087)

           at au.com.observant.server.Hub.start(Hub.java:320)

           at au.com.observant.cmanager.UIStarter.main(UIStarter.java:20)

           at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

           at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)

           at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

           at java.lang.reflect.Method.invoke(Method.java:592)

           at apple.launcher.LaunchRunner.run(LaunchRunner.java:115)

           at apple.launcher.LaunchRunner.callMain(LaunchRunner.java:50)

           at apple.launcher.JavaApplicationLauncher.launch(JavaApplicationLauncher.java:52)

      Caused by: au.com.observant.ringocore.dispatcher.api.manager.DispatcherManagerException: Failed to start message broker component

           at au.com.observant.ringocore.dispatcher.manager.ActiveMQDispatcherManager.start(ActiveMQDispatcherManager.java:318)

           at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

           at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)

           at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

           at java.lang.reflect.Method.invoke(Method.java:592)

           at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eCustomInitMethod(AbstractAutowireCapableBeanFactory.java:1413)

           at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eInitMethods(AbstractAutowireCapableBeanFactory.java:1374)

           at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1334)

           ... 22 more

      Caused by: org.apache.activemq.kaha.impl.index.BadMagicException

           at org.apache.activemq.kaha.impl.index.IndexItem.read(IndexItem.java:141)

           at org.apache.activemq.kaha.impl.index.StoreIndexReader.readItem(StoreIndexReader.java:50)

           at org.apache.activemq.kaha.impl.index.IndexManager.initialize(IndexManager.java:207)

           at org.apache.activemq.kaha.impl.index.IndexManager.